Country Walks: For Little Folks is a book written by Job Buffum and published in 1856. The book is a guide for parents and children who want to explore the countryside and learn about the natural world around them. It features a collection of short stories and descriptions of different plants, animals, and geological formations that can be found on walks in the countryside. The book is aimed at children and is written in a simple, easy-to-understand language that is accessible to young readers. It also includes illustrations to help children identify the different plants and animals they may encounter on their walks.
